What They Do

A Sales Support Representative provides administrative support to sales and field sales representatives. Assists with creating sales proposals or sales presentations and demonstrations, and maintains records related to sales May obtain and document price quotes for customers; may process customer orders.


Core Tasks:

  • Greet customers and ascertain what each customer wants or needs.
  • Recommend, select, and help locate or obtain merchandise based on customer needs and desires.
  • Compute sales prices, total purchases, and receive and process cash or credit payment.
  • Prepare merchandise for purchase or rental.
  • Answer questions regarding the store and its merchandise.
  • Maintain knowledge of current sales and promotions, policies regarding payment and exchanges, and security practices.
  • Describe merchandise and explain use, operation, and care of merchandise to customers.
  • Demonstrate use or operation of merchandise.
  • Ticket, arrange, and display merchandise to promote sales.
  • Exchange merchandise for customers and accept returns.
  • Inventory stock and requisition new stock.
  • Watch for and recognize security risks and thefts and know how to prevent or handle these situations.
  • Place special orders or call other stores to find desired items.
  • Clean shelves, counters, and tables.
